Pomphlett Close is in Plymouth and in Plymouth district. PL9 7QT is located in the Plymstock Radford elect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of South West Devon.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ding PL9 7QT,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.3%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Pomphlett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Pomphlett Close was 15.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 71.1% lower than the Plymstock Radford average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Pomphlett Close has the 5th lowest crime rate of 35 local areas in Plymstock Radford and the 73rd lowest crime rate of 837 local areas in Plymouth .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 9.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-66.2%.

Employment

PL9 7QT area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
